首頁 > 資料庫 > mysql教程 > Linux平台下Oracle ASM磁盘组添加磁盘

Linux平台下Oracle ASM磁盘组添加磁盘

WBOY
發布: 2016-06-07 17:03:30
原創
911 人瀏覽過

以下为Linux平台下Oracle ASM磁盘组添加磁盘的主要操作,多路进软件使用的是HDS的。一.操作系统设置1.从存储映射磁盘到服务器,然

以下为Linux平台下Oracle ASM磁盘组添加磁盘的主要操作,多路进软件使用的是HDS的。

一.操作系统设置

1.从存储映射磁盘到服务器,然后重启,扫描磁盘

/opt/D*/bin/dlnkmgr view -lu

2.扫描到新的磁盘后(两个节点都要扫描,,并且盘符要一致),在新盘上建分区(在任意一个节点执行)

fdisk /dev/sddlmax

fdisk /dev/sddlmay

查看分区

fdisk -l /dev/sddlmax

fdisk -l /dev/sddlmay

在另一个节点执行:

partprobe

查看分区

fdisk -l /dev/sddlmax

fdisk -l /dev/sddlmay

3.建立vol盘

在一个节点上执行:

/etc/init.d/oracleasm createdisk VOLDB7 /dev/sddlmax1

/etc/init.d/oracleasm createdisk VOLDB8 /dev/sddlmay1

ls -l /dev/oracleasm/disks

查看

/etc/init.d/oracleasm listdisks

在另一个节点执行:

/etc/init.d/oracleasm scandisks

然后查看:

/etc/init.d/oracleasm listdisks

二.数据库设置

export ORACLE_SID=+ASM1

sqlplus "/ as sysdba"

show parameter pfile                    注意看ASM_DISKSTRING参数有没有设置的

show parameter asm_power

alter system set asm_power_limit=5;

alter diskgroup DBDATA  add disk  'ORCL:VOLDB7';

alter diskgroup DBDATA  add disk  'ORCL:VOLDB8';

ALTER DISKGROUP DBDATA REBALANCE POWER 5;     提高平衡速率

select operation,est_minutes from v$asm_operation;     查看平衡需要的时间

select TOTAL_MB,FREE_MB,path from v$asm_disk_stat where GROUP_NUMBER=1 order by 3;    查看当前磁盘空间使用情况 

ALTER DISKGROUP DBDATA REBALANCE POWER 1;     恢复到平衡速率为1

linux

來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
最新問題
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板